Introduction

The HUB remote functions as a standard trigger, similar to the CyberSync Trigger Transmitter. It provides necessary communication between any camera brand and a Paul C. Buff, Inc. flash unit. To utilize TTL and HSS capabilities of a Paul C. Buff, Inc. flash unit equipped with these features (e.g., the LINK), a camera-specific version of the HUB is required.

Attaching the HUB to Your Camera

Slide the bottom of the HUB onto your camera's hot shoe. Turn the locking wheel clockwise to secure the HUB to your camera.

Charging the HUB

To charge the HUB, plug the USB-C side of the included charging cable directly into the HUB. Then, plug the USB-A side into a wall outlet connector.

Powering the HUB On / Off

Press and hold the POWER button, located on the right side of the HUB, for two seconds to power the device on or off.

Sending a Test Fire

Press the rotary wheel, located on the left side of the HUB, to send a test fire to any flash units that are on the same frequency.

The rear display shows key information:

  • 8. FREQUENCY: Displays the current operating frequency (e.g., '15').
  • 9. TTL/MAN and HSS: Indicates the current mode, such as TTL (Through-The-Lens metering), Manual, or HSS (High-Speed Sync).
  • 10. BATTERY INDICATOR: Shows the remaining battery level.
  • 11. BLUETOOTH: Indicates the status of the Bluetooth connection.

Setting the Frequency

The FREQUENCY ranges from 1 to 16. To set the frequency, turn the ROTARY WHEEL until 'FREQUENCY' appears on the display. Press the ROTARY WHEEL to enter the FREQUENCY section. Turn the ROTARY WHEEL until your desired frequency appears. Press the ROTARY WHEEL again to confirm your selection.

Adjusting the Display Brightness

To adjust the display brightness, turn the ROTARY WHEEL until 'BRIGHTNESS' appears on the display. Press the ROTARY WHEEL to enter the BRIGHTNESS section. Turn the ROTARY WHEEL until your desired brightness level appears.

Bluetooth

By default, BLUETOOTH is ON when the HUB is first activated. To turn BLUETOOTH ON or OFF, turn the ROTARY WHEEL until 'BLUETOOTH' appears on the display. Press the ROTARY WHEEL to enter the BLUETOOTH section. Turn the ROTARY WHEEL to toggle between ON and OFF. Press the ROTARY WHEEL to confirm your selection.

TTL Mode

To set the HUB into TTL mode, turn the ROTARY WHEEL until 'TTL' appears on the display. Press the ROTARY WHEEL to enter the TTL section. Turn the ROTARY WHEEL to toggle between TTL and MAN (for manual). Press the ROTARY WHEEL to confirm your selection.

HSS Mode

The HUB will enter HSS mode automatically when your camera is set above its maximum sync speed. The HUB will also supersede any settings found on the LINK. For example, if the LINK is set to COLOR MODE but you are shooting above your camera's max sync speed, the HUB will adjust the LINK and place it into HSS MODE.

About

To access the serial number, current firmware version, and FCC ID within the HUB interface, first turn on the HUB and use the rotary dial to scroll to the 'ABOUT' section. Once 'ABOUT' appears on the display, press the rotary dial to enter the section. Finally, scroll using the rotary dial to view each item.
